Q: Is 25,902,380 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 25,902,380 is a composite number.

Why is 25,902,380 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 25,902,380 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 7 10 14 20 28 35 49 70 98 140 196 245 490 980 26,431 52,862 105,724 132,155 185,017 264,310 370,034 528,620 740,068 925,085 1,295,119 1,850,170 2,590,238 3,700,340 5,180,476 6,475,595 12,951,190 and 25,902,380, with no remainder.

Since 25,902,380 cannot be divided by just 1 and 25,902,380, it is a composite number.
